Understanding 2FA

Before delving into the solutions, it is paramount to understand what 2FA is. 2FA is a security process that requires users to provide two different authentication factors to verify their identity. This method is a layer of security designed to ensure that a user is who they claim to be. It typically requires a combination of something the user knows (like a password), something the user has (like a physical token or a mobile phone), and something the user is (like a fingerprint or other biometric element).

Common 2FA Issue Problems

Some of the common problems users face with 2FA include losing access to the device linked to their 2FA, forgetting their 2FA backup codes, or not receiving 2FA verification codes. These issues can hinder a user’s ability to access their accounts, leading to frustration and potential security risks.

Step-by-Step Guide to Solving 2FA Issue Problems

Addressing 2FA issue problems involves a series of steps that vary depending on the specific problem encountered.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

  • If you’ve lost access to your 2FA device, contact the support team of the platform you’re trying to access. They may be able to assist you in regaining access to your account.
  • If you’ve forgotten your 2FA backup codes, again, contacting the support team of the platform is recommended. You may also want to check if you have stored them in a safe place that you might have forgotten about.
  • If you’re not receiving 2FA verification codes, ensure that you have a good internet or cellular connection, as this might affect code delivery. Also, check if the platform’s servers are down, which could impact code delivery.

Practical Tips

Always store your 2FA backup codes in a secure and accessible location. Regularly update your 2FA settings to match your current device and contact information. Be patient and systematic in your approach to solving 2FA issue problems.
